Fruit excl Melons, Total — Producer Price Index in Germany
Germany: Fruit excl Melons, Total — Producer Price Index was 145.05 in 2025. ▲ Rising
Fruit excl Melons, Total — Producer Price Index in Germany, 1991–2025
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ations.
Analysis
The most recent figure for fruit excl melons, total — producer price index in Germany is 145.05,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 35 years on record.
That represents a change of up 0.2% on the previous year and up 49.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, fruit excl melons, total — producer price index in Germany peaked at 145.05 in 2025 and was at its lowest, 56.59, in 1999.
Germany ranks 74th of 145 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 35 years of available data.

About this data
This sub-domain contains data on agriculture producer prices and the producer price index. Agriculture producer prices are prices received by farmers for primary crops, live animals and livestock primary products as collected at the point of initial sale (prices paid at the farm gate). Annual data are provided from 1991 (while mothly data start in January 2010) for 180 countries and 212 products. The producer price index is the index of agricultural producer prices that measures the average annual change over time in the selling prices received by farmers (prices at the farm gate or at the first point of sale). The three categories of producer price index available in FAOSTAT comprise: single-item price index, commodity group index and the agriculture producer price index.
